The Role We Want You For

LJC is seeking a Mechanical / HVAC Lead Engineer to provide technical leadership in the planning, design, and delivery of building mechanical systems for life sciences manufacturing facilities, including pharmaceutical and biotechnology production environments. This role focuses on air-side systems and building-side mechanical utilities that support manufacturing operations, cleanrooms, and controlled environments, with laboratory and office spaces comprising a smaller portion of overall project scope.

The Mechanical / HVAC Lead Engineer plays a key role in early project definition, system strategy development, and multidisciplinary coordination within a design-build delivery model. This position is suited for a licensed mechanical engineer experienced in manufacturing-focused life sciences facilities and complex, regulated environments.

The Specifics of the Role

  • Lead the design of building mechanical systems for life sciences manufacturing projects, including HVAC and building-side wet utilities, from early planning through construction support.
  • Develop air-side system strategies that support manufacturing cleanrooms and controlled environments, including pressure relationships, air change rates, filtration, redundancy, and system resiliency.
  • Plan and coordinate building-side wet utilities such as plant steam, heating hot water, chilled water, condenser water, domestic water, and sanitary and industrial waste systems.
  • Collaborate with architects, engineers, and construction teams to integrate mechanical systems with manufacturing layouts, equipment rooms, and support spaces.
  • Support front-end project efforts by contributing to proposals, system narratives, conceptual layouts, and client presentations.
  • Lead technical discussions with clients related to system performance, operational reliability, energy use, maintainability, and lifecycle considerations.
  • Coordinate with construction teams to support design-build delivery, constructability reviews, and phased execution strategies.
  • Develop and/or review calculations, drawings, and specifications to ensure quality, consistency, and alignment with project and regulatory requirements.
  • Ensure compliance with applicable codes, standards, and guidelines, including ASHRAE, NFPA, GMP/GxP, and local regulations.
  • Participate in multidisciplinary coordination reviews to ensure mechanical systems are fully integrated with architectural and other engineering systems.
  • Mentor and support the development of junior mechanical engineers and designers.
  • Contribute to the development of LJC’s mechanical design standards, tools, and best practices for life sciences manufacturing facilities.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ering or a related field.
  • Professional Engineer (PE) licensure required.
  • 10–20+ years of experience designing building mechanical systems for life sciences manufacturing, pharmaceutical, biotechnology, or other regulated production facilities.
  • Demonstrated experience leading HVAC and building-side mechanical utility design on manufacturing-focused projects.
  • Strong understanding of air-side systems and building-side wet utilities supporting manufacturing cleanrooms and controlled environments.
  • Experience coordinating mechanical systems with manufacturing layouts, electrical systems, and building infrastructure.
  • Working knowledge of applicable codes and standards, including ASHRAE, NFPA, GMP/GxP, and relevant local regulations.
  • Experience working in a design-build or fast-track project delivery environment preferred.
  • Strong communication skills, with the ability to lead technical discussions, client meetings, and pursuit presentations.
  • Familiarity with Revit and BIM-based coordination workflows.
  • Ability to collaborate effectively across multidisciplinary teams and manage multiple priorities.
